Engine oil viscosity grades explained | TotalEnergies

These are SAE 0W, 5W, 10W, 15W, 20W, and 25W engine oils. Their viscosity grade is low, meaning they are particularly fluid lubricants. Each category is defined by its viscosity at a given temperature (from -10°C to -35°C, depending on the grade). When cold, the more fluid the lubricant, the less work is required by the oil pump during start-up.

Silver processing | Refining, Mining & Uses | Britannica

Jewelry sweeps, the fine dust generated in the polishing and grinding of precious metals, are usually smelted to form an impure silver, which is electrorefined. Because of the much lower value of silver scrap, recycling techniques applicable to gold (e.g., cyanidation of low-grade scrap) are uneconomic for silver.

Silver Recovery from Scrap and Low-Grade Residue

Up to 95% of silver and copper has been recovered from electrolysis of spent solar cells in research studies, and a standard silicon solar cell module of 60 cells contains approximately 6 g of silver. At a 95% recovery, 5.7 g (0.183 ozt) of silver at $15.79 USD/ ozt equates to $2.89 USD/module.
